Metzineres, the non-profit cooperative in Raval that assists women in vulnerable situations, must leave its premises at carrer de la Lluna, 3, before June 30 because the property will not renew the rental contract. The entity is asking administrations for a stable space in the neighborhood to avoid the closure of a service that about 60 women attend daily.

The paradox is that the resource loses its headquarters after having been recognized by the Generalitat de Catalunya as a Specialized Intervention Service and having received at the end of 2024 the Award from the Catalan Observatory of Justice for Machista Violence. Without a new location in El Raval, the immediate alternative is to be left without physical space.

Metzineres must leave the premises on Lluna street before June 30

The cooperative operates in a 120-square-meter space in the Raval neighborhood. There it organizes meals and workshops, has a cleaning area with showers and bunk beds, a small infirmary, and an outdoor patio with washing machines.

Aura Roig, president and founder of Metzineres, places the problem in the loss of roots and basic coverage. Daily, about sixty women pass through the premises, many of them homeless, victims of gender violence, and with substance abuse.

"Moving out of Raval is already a problem because we are neighbors of the neighborhood, but if we don't renew, what's left for us is the street" - Aura Roig, president and founder, Metzineres

Founded in 2017, the entity has specialized in the care of women who chain several situations of vulnerability. The premises on carrer de la Lluna act as a daily reception point and also as a stable reference within the neighborhood.

Roig adds that losing this space will be like losing his home, a point of reference and security. The warning comes as the entity already takes for granted that it will not continue in the current headquarters beyond June.

The entity gathered more than 3,000 signatures to demand a stable space in the neighborhood

Faced with the forced departure, Metzineres has launched a signature collection campaign to demand an alternative in El Raval from the administrations. So far, it has garnered more than 3,000 signatures.

Maria Lech, a community technician for the entity, describes the bond that is built within the premises and the role it plays in the daily reception of users.

"We are like a family and from the first moment a woman arrives here, we make her part of our family. When they come, they realize they are not alone" - Maria Lech, community technician, Metzineres

The participants also place the value of the space in the intimacy and security it offers. In a facility of reduced dimensions, basic services, support, and a place to rest coexist in the heart of Raval.

Manu, a participant in Metzineres, summarizes that function with a direct request, arguing that there is no other place like it for her. The venue combines showers, bunk beds, a nursing station, and washing machines at a single point of care.

"From the first moment I arrived I felt I had an intimate, safe place, with companions, there is no other place like this. I cannot describe in words what this place is, all I know is that it cannot be closed" - Manu, participant, Metzineres

The Generalitat de Catalunya recognized Metzineres as a Specialized Intervention Service in 2020 and the Catalan Observatory of Justice for Machista Violence awarded it one of its prizes at the end of 2024.
